Cincinnati Football: Bearcats Announce 2012 Football Schedule
The Cincinnati Bearcats announced their official 2012 college football schedule on Tuesday, and it features seven home games and three Big East road trips.
With the departure of TCU to the Big 12, Cincinnati had a void to fill and was unable to get a home-and-home with a BCS school, forcing them to settle for Fordham.
Scheduling Fordham and Delaware State gives Cincinnati two FCS schools, something they certainly did not want to have to do.
Cincinnati will open the season on Sept. 6 in a Thursday night, nationally-televised game on ESPN against Pittsburgh at Nippert Stadium.
They will then begin the non-conference portion of their schedule with a game against Delaware State at home before heading into a bye week.
The big non-conference road test will follow, with Cincinnati traveling to Washington D.C. to take on Virginia Tech.
Cincinnati will then return home to take on Miami (OH) and Fordham before traveling to Toledo for the final non-conference game of the slate.
The remaining Big East games feature road contests against Louisville, Temple and Connecticut with home games against Syracuse, Rutgers and South Florida.
This may not be the schedule that Cincinnati had envisioned a year ago, but it is favorable with seven games at home and only three Big East road games.
With the Big East champion earning an automatic BCS berth, winning the conference is still the No. 1 priority, and it all starts with the season opener against Pittsburgh.
